#42791d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#42791d is composed of 25.9% red, 47.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 95.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#42791d color hex could be obtained by blending #84f23a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#42791d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#42791d has RGB values of R:66, G:121,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4356381.

Shades and Tints of #42791d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a02 is the darkest color, while #fbfef9 is the lightest one.
